Project thinking

How we turn a promising idea into a workable piece

The following checks are practical rather than decorative. Together they determine whether the furniture remains comfortable, serviceable and convincing once it is in daily use.

01

Light changes the finish

Colour and grain are assessed against daylight and artificial light. This is especially important for contemporary coastal interiors, where a sample viewed under showroom lighting can read very differently at home.

02

Start with the awkward part

Every room has one condition that drives the rest: a pillar, a low socket, a door swing, a sloping ceiling or a tight route in. We identify it early. For a project in Estepona, we also include site rules in new developments in that first review.

03

Space on paper is not usable space

Nominal dimensions do not show how a drawer opens beside a bed or how a door passes a table. We draw the movement around made-to-measure shoe storage, then adjust the composition so it remains comfortable in use.

04

The quote should match the drawing

Interior fittings, visible ends, lighting, cut-outs, delivery and fitting are named in the scope. That lets you compare alternatives without wondering what has silently disappeared from the price.

05

Materials need a reason

A premium surface is not automatically the right surface. We compare touch, repairability, resistance and cleaning, and explain where a simpler material may perform better.

06

Allow for the next five years

We ask how use might change, not only what is needed this month. Adjustable elements and sensible access can extend the useful life of the piece without making it overcomplicated.

Materials chosen for the way made-to-measure shoe storage will be used

We shortlist boards, finishes and hardware after considering load, moisture, light, cleaning, repairability and the investment available.

Structure and thicknessSized for the span, weight, fixing points and type of use rather than selected by habit.
Surface and edgesCompared for touch, resistance, sheen and how easily marks or local damage can be dealt with.
Moving partsHinges, runners and opening systems are matched to door size, load and expected cycles.
Samples in contextColours and textures are checked beside the finishes and light that will remain in the room.

Before approval, we explain what each proposed material changes in appearance, care, durability and price.

What can change the price of made-to-measure shoe storage?

Overall size matters, but internal fittings, door count, material, hardware, lighting and site access can matter just as much. We price the agreed configuration rather than applying a flat rate per metre.

What happens if the walls are not square?

The measured design allows for tolerances, scribes and finishing pieces. Final adjustment is carried out during fitting so doors and visible lines remain properly aligned.

Can I enquire before I have exact measurements?

Yes. A few photographs and approximate dimensions are enough for an initial conversation. Manufacturing dimensions are confirmed only after the design direction and site conditions are clear.

Can you work from an inspiration image?

Certainly. A reference is useful for proportion and atmosphere, but it still needs to be adapted to your dimensions, storage needs and realistic materials.

How is access in Estepona dealt with?

Before manufacture we confirm the floor, lift, stairs, parking or loading restrictions and the route through the property. Module sizes and the fitting sequence are then planned around those facts.
